Pennsylvania's General Adoption Statutes
Pennsylvania
Agency or Person Gathering Information
or Preparing Report Statute: 23 Pa. §§ 2533; 2535
- • Public or voluntary child care agency
- • Adoption agency
- • Intermediary who arranged the adoption
- • Social worker
- • Person designated by court
Contents of Report About Person to be
Adopted Statute: 23 Pa. §§ 2533; 2535
- • Physical, mental, and emotional needs
- • Age, sex, race
- • Religious background
- • Description and value of property owned
Contents of Report About Birth Parents
Statute: 23 Pa. § 2533
- • Age, marital status when child was born and
during the year prior to birth of adopted person
- • Racial and religious background
- • Residence if rights have not yet been
terminated
- • Medical history
Contents of Report About Adoptive
Parents Statute: 23 Pa. §§ 2530; 2535
• Suitability
• Age
• Home environment
• Family life, parenting skills
• Physical and mental health
• Social, cultural, and religious
background
• Facilities and resources
• Ability to manage resources
